The first step to Candle Making is to start out by preparing the wax. This is done by melting the wax in a double boiler. Double Boilers are basically pots of water that are placed on a stove top and set to boil. Then a second smaller pot that contains the wax is sat insider the larger pot and left to melt. The reason for doing it this way is, if you were to just melt wax with say, a flame. Then the wax will also burn instead of melting.
The next stage is to take the melted candle wax and pour it into a mold. During this stage the wick is also held into place. Next allow the wax to cool, it is recommended to leave the candle for about four to six hours before removing it from the mold.
You now know the basic fundamentals of creating a candle, but it doesn’t stop at that. There is almost endless possible ways to customize and create different types of candles. Such as changing the fragrances, colors and even adding your own unique decorations. Some candle makers even take it one step further by creating their own molds out of latex, resulting in some amazing and extremely unique candles.
The only problem with making your own latex molds is that they are generally a lot less sturdy, and if not made correctly. They will not be able to hold the melted wax without losing their shape and form.
